    Mouse pointer changes only when on Start Menu


    Hi Folks,

    I have run into a curious and frustrating problem that I can't seem to get a handle on or find any solutions from searching here and Google.

    My mouse pointer has suddenly changed when it's anywhere on the start menu. Instead of the basic white arrow, it's now the vertical style black pointer with the arrows pointing up and down. Sometimes it changes to the move pointer with the four arrows extending outward.

    I have not installed or uninstalled any programs recently. Nor have I installed any updates in the past few days. In addition I have reinstalled the device drivers for my graphics cards and attempted to change the schemes for the mouse pointers, but the issue remains. I have also unplugged my USB Trackball and restarted the computer so it only uses the built-in trackpad, but that didn't help anything either.

    If anyone could give me any tips of how I could get the mouse pointer to return to normal, I'd very much appreciate it.

    I have spent the last few days going through the various steps you listed and wasn't able to find anything wrong with my system.

    However, I needed to use my external hard drive on another computer in the meantime and after it was unplugged from the USB port, I noticed the mouse cursor in the Start Menu had returned to normal. When I plugged the drive back in again, the cursor remained normal, but upon restarting the computer, it was back to the different styles that keep showing up. As soon as the drive is unplugged again, then the cursor appears normally. Not sure what an external hard drive has to do with the display of cursors in the Start Menu, but at least I know now what the problem is. I'll just keep the drive unplugged all the time until it's actually necessary.
